"Stevens Favorite Ladies Model No. 21 .22 LR (R29015)
Description: " Very fine example. Rifle was manufactured from 1910 to 1916. Barrel length is 24"". Swiss style butt plate. Folding Beeches front sight and Vernier tang rear sight. Receiver has vivid case colors. Stocks are nicely figured walnut with sharp crisp checkering. Forend finishes with a schnaubel tip. Rare to find in such fine condition. SOLD Curio/Relic: Yes |
